About this food

Mango nectar belongs to the Fruits category. Potassium levels vary widely across fruits - apples and berries are low-potassium, kidney-friendly picks, while bananas and avocados are high and need portion control. The natural sugar in fruit is usually not the issue; potassium is.

How much Potassium is in Mango nectar?

Per 100 g, Mango nectar contains Potassium 24 mg, which is 1% of the CKD stage 3-4 daily limit (2,000 mg).

Is Mango nectar safe on a low-potassium diet?

On a low-potassium diet, Mango nectar falls below the 300 mg per 100 g reference point, providing 24 mg of Potassium. Treat this as a reference - your stage and labs decide the real target.
